Mu Zi grew up with her mother's denial and developed a low self-esteem, cowardly and cold character until she met Bai Hao in her sophomore year of high school.
The first time she met Bai Hao alone, he fell off his skateboard and half-knelt in front of her.
She was invited to a classmate's birthday party, and Bai Hao smeared cream on her face.
She was worried about the college entrance examination. Bai Hao, who had excellent grades, said: "I have always been very lucky. Let me share some of my good luck with you."

Maybe some of Bai Hao's good luck really passed on to her. Mu Zi, who had average grades and a mediocre appearance, did well in the college entrance examination. She accidentally enrolled in a university in Bai Hao's city.
Whenever she meets a suitor, Mu Zi always thinks to herself: His eyes are not as good-looking as Bai Hao's; his nose is not as straight as Bai Hao's; his skin is not as fair as Bai Hao's; his hair is not as thick as Bai Hao's; his voice is not as nice as Bai Hao's...
Until they met again, Bai Hao was no longer the handsome, high-spirited young man in her memory. He was disfigured, wore sunglasses all day long, and ignored her.
And she sadly discovered that she would still be moved by him, and she could only be moved by him.
I don't know where the love started, but it goes deeper and deeper.
